What’s MANAPUA?!?

A mentoring program that empowers students to recognize valuable insights and knowledge about themselves, their cultural identities, college academics, how to address life challenges (both as an individual and as a group), as well as how to build and create community!

Why join MANAPUA?

  • Develop leadership skills to help cultivate a holistic self!
  • Acquire tactics and strategies to support academic success!
  • Build a community within Foothill College!
  • Learn methodologies on how to navigate and better understand your cultural identity!

Who can join MANAPUA?

All Foothill College students, including International Students!
Students must intend to enroll in Winter & Spring 2026 Academic terms

Why the name MANAPUA?

MANAPUA stands for Mentorship & Academics Nexus Ascension Program Uplifting AANHPI (Asian American, Native Hawaiian, Pacific Islanders).

Those in the know will also know that manapua is the Hawaiian name for pork buns, an adaptation of Chinese baozi buns.

Asian and Pacifika communities often use food as their love language. Families will often ask "have you eaten?" rather than "how are you?" and will show care and concern through offering food, fruits, and other nourishments.

Many of us learned important life lessons while sitting around a kitchen table with our friends and families or learning how to make traditional dishes from the previous generations. It's through these food traditions that our culture is passed down.
